Payroll is often considered a back-office administrative function of finance or HR, but did you know that the actual value of payroll is the payroll data?

This sentiment is echoed in Access Group's 2024 Payroll Research Report.

The Report highlights that 43% of business leaders believe their payroll is only used for record-keeping, paying employees and compliance. 

'Human Capital is arguably the largest cost centre of an organisation and typically the most difficult to manage without supporting data.'

On the 27th of February, The Workplace Gender Equality Agency (WGEA) released data on gender pay gaps (publicly available here) which was collated based on the findings of 5,000 individual private sector employers with 100 or more employees, and the evidence is compelling and unequivocal.  

While the publication of gender pay data represents a critical milestone for gender equality in Australia, the subsequent actions, particularly within the recruitment industry, hold greater significance. An ecommerce warehouse is far more than merely a facility for storing stock. Home to scores of pickers, packers and increasingly, automated machinery and robots, it serves as the backbone of the order fulfilment process.

The warehouse is where a range of people, fulfilment strategies and critical processes all come together to ensure orders are picked, packed and delivered to the customer as swiftly as possible.

Ecommerce warehouses come in many different forms – from fulfilment and distribution centres to automated warehouses and even, in the case of fledgling businesses, a garage or spare bedroom.

All these different warehouses have one thing in common – the need to constantly refine processes and cut out manual work, often with the help of the latest technology.
